The fall production of Sun Lakes Community Theatre is the classic drama, “Twelve Angry Jurors,” which will be staged in the San Tan Ballroom Nov. 7-11.
All shows Nov. 7-10 will be at 7 p.m., and on Nov. 11 there will be a matinee at 1 p.m.
The play is based on the Emmy-winning TV movie by Reginald Rose and adapted by Sherman Sergel, in which a young man is accused of murder so the 12 jurors enter the jury room to consider the evidence and decide his fate.
It will be performed in an intimate three-quarter round format, which means that the audience surrounds the actors on three sides and each audience member sits close to the action.
